Among the techniques that allow us to know the function of the brain, practically in real time, are electroencephalography and Functional Near Infrared Spectroscopy (fNIRS). In addition, they are considered minimally invasive techniques, as they require at least contact with the skin of the person to be evaluated. a Electroencephalography measures the electrical activity of neurons, using methods that record the activity, such as synapses. (fNIRS) measures changes in oxygen concentration providing information on cognitive, emotional and neurological processes, useful in research and clinical diagnosis, allowing a glimpse into the brain.
